This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] DCA1000EVM:以太网连接、SPI 连接

Guru**** 1956995 points
Other Parts Discussed in Thread: AWR1243BOOST, DCA1000EVM, AWR1243, UNIFLASH
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/sensors-group/sensors/f/sensors-forum/717432/dca1000evm-ethernetconnection-spi-connection

器件型号:DCA1000EVM
主题中讨论的其他器件:AWR1243BOOSTAWR1243UNIFLASH

您好!

今天、我设法使 AWR1243BOOST 和 DCA1000的设置部分正常工作、但我也遇到了一些有关成功使用的错误。

1.为电路板加电后、AWR1243BOOST 板上的红色 NERR LED 会立即亮起。 当我尝试连接 SPI 时、会出现超时错误(请参阅所附的第一个日志)。 当再次按下 GUI 中的 RESET 时、红色 NERR LED 熄灭、可能会发生 SPI 连接。 在首次尝试 SPI 连接之前、在 mmWave Studio 中按 RESET 并不会改变任何内容(即 SPI 连接必须失败、 然后按下 RESET、然后 SPI 可以连接)。

2.我不断收到一条错误消息,表明以太网电缆已断开连接(使用设置 DCA1000窗口时),即使电缆已牢固连接。 重新启动 mmWavestudio 时有时会修复此问题、在同一点出现许多故障并重新启动 mmWave Studio 几次后、我获得了要识别的以太网连接、并使用数据采集演示脚本成功运行了三次。 但是,随后的尝试似乎中断了 etherrnet 连接,但失败了(参见第二个附加日志)。

3.在打开和关闭 mmWave Studio 并对电路板进行下电上电后(每次上电时必须处理错误编号1)、以太网连接再次可用、并且许多运行成功(请参阅第三个附加日志)。

4现在、以太网连接似乎已连接(即没有显示已断开连接的错误消息、并且 DCA1000设置屏幕如用户指南中所述) 但是、当一个帧被触发时、LVDS 缓冲器溢出 LED 灯呈红色亮起、并且在输出窗口中收到消息:STS_LVDS_Buffer_Full 异步事件(9)(请参阅所附的第四个日志 e2e.ti.com/.../LVDSBuffferlogverbose.txt)。 现在、通过重新启动 mmWave Studio、为电路板下电上电以及重新启动 PC、这种情况仍然存在。

有什么想法可以导致这种极不稳定的性能?

谢谢、

Sam Bonsor

e2e.ti.com/.../ManySuccessesverbose.txte2e.ti.com/.../3_5F00_successes_5F00_then_5F00_failverbose.txte2e.ti.com/.../FailonStartlogLEDonVerbose.txt

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    日志似乎没有按照正确的顺序附加、日志文件的名称应告知它们与哪个部分相关。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好!

    您能否与我们分享 PC 上使用的 Windows 版本?

    谢谢你
    Cesar
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Windows 7 Professional Service Pack 1 64位

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    在今天重试时、仍然会出现错误1和4。

    谢谢、
    Sam
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    按下触发帧时、这会出现在 Wireshark 中。 另外,另一次尝试完全关闭防火墙时也出现了同样的问题。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    我刚刚在运行 Windows 10的单独计算机上尝试了相同的步骤集。 出现相同的错误(1后跟4)。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    我有相同的问题。 我甚至无法从 Windows 10主机 ping 192.168.33.180。 在防火墙关闭的情况下尝试。 已尝试使用 Wireshark 进行调试。 我无法到达目的地。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    我们的 DCA1000EVM - AWR1243BOOST 设置具有相同的行为。
    以太网连接问题使其无法使用。
    TI、您能就如何查找问题提供任何建议吗?
    谢谢、
    mmUser
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    所有、

    请确保已安装 Microsoft Visual C++ 2013 Redistributable 程序包的32位和64位版本。

    此致、
    Kyle
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    这不能解决我的问题、我已经安装了这两个。

    谢谢、

    Sam

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    此外、我认为红色点亮的 LED 是 FPGA_ERR_LED2、是第六个。 只需提供它的正确名称。

    伴随着绿色 DATA_TRANS_PROG_LED1。 然后、当按下"Connexions (连接)"选项卡中的"RESET (复位)"时、此选项不会关闭;当按下"RESET (复位)"时、FPGA_ERR_LED2选项卡中的此选项不会关闭。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    只需将一切放在一个位置:仅使用 SOP0跳线为电路板(DCA1000和 AWR1243BOOST)上电、然后放置 SOP1跳线并按下 AWR1243BOOST 板上的 NRST 即可解决 SPI 连接问题。

    以太网连接问题仍然存在。 我在这里对出现的两个问题作了另一总结。

    1.收到错误消息,表示以太网电缆已断开连接,尽管已成功插入。
    2.如果检测到以太网电缆已连接、则当按下触发帧时、DCA1000上的红色 FPGA_ERR LED 会亮起、同时绿色 DATA_TRAM_PRG LED 会亮起。 在 Wireshark 中、DCA1000和 PC 似乎在交换数据包时已连接(请参阅随附的图片)。 根据 Wireshark (设置 DCA1000步骤完成时图像中的小数据包除外)、没有数据传输、而这些数据文件是空数据文件所证实的。 按下"connections"选项卡中的"reset"时、红色 LED 会熄灭、但 DATA_TRAM_PRG LED 仍保持亮起。

    DCA1000上的开关设置如下:

    SW2.1 LVDS_Capt
    SW2.2 ETH_STREAM
    SW2.3 1243_MODE
    SW2.4 RAW_MODE
    SW2.5 SW_CONFIG
    SW2.6 USER_SW1
    SW2.7 USER_SW2
    SW2.8 USER_SW3

    SW1.1关闭
    SW1.2关闭
    SW1.3打开

    16位数据。

    使用的电源是两个2.5A 5V 直流电源。

    所用 PC 的操作系统是 Windows 7专业服务包1 64位。

    我相信两个 Microsoft Visual C++ 2013可再发行版本都已安装。 (我附上已安装程序的图片)。

    我使用的是 mmWave Studio 1.0.0.0版。

    附件是最近尝试失败的日志。

    由于目前设置无法使用(自8月9日以来、以及在此之前、自7月中旬以来、未能成功捕获数据)、因此我们将不胜感激。

    谢谢、

    Sam

    e2e.ti.com/.../Problem-log.txt

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Sam、您好!

    我知道这是一个漫长的讨论链、但请您帮助我们提供这些信息

    1. FPGA 固件版本:当您单击"Setup DCA1000"按钮并通过网络进行连接时、会在弹出窗口中显示该版本。

    2. AWR1243器件版本:通过 SPI 进行连接时,可在 mMWaveStudio 屏幕的 Connection 选项卡(器件状态和芯片 ID)中获取此信息。

    3.在 LVDS 溢出的情况下,您是否使用连续流模式还是组帧模式?

    4.每当您执行复位时、都会通过 mmWaveStudio 的"复位控制"或对两个板进行物理循环供电(AWR1243+DCA1000)

    需要考虑的要点-

    1.如果 DCA1000连接一次、并且在单击"重置控制"按钮重置 AWR1243时、您无需使用"设置 DCA1000"重新连接到 DCA1000。 因此、尝试多次跳过"Setup DCA1000"。

    2.确保在连接 SPI 之前擦除 AWR1243 sFlash。

    此致、

    Jitendra

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    Jitendra、您好!

    1.FPGA 版本:2.7记录位文件
    DLL 版本:2.7

    2.器件状态:XWR1243/ASIL-B/SOP:2/ES:2
    芯片 ID:Lot:6000001/Wafer:1/DevX:67/DevY:84

    我正在使用 mmWave Studio 中的默认帧配置的组帧模式(帧数= 8、线性调频脉冲环路数= 128)。

    4.我正在使用"connections"选项卡中的 mmWave studio 复位按钮。

    关于建议:

    1.您是否说如果我在连接选项卡中按重置、则 DCA1000不需要再次设置? 当我尝试执行此操作时、传感器配置选项卡中的 ARM DCA1000按钮呈灰色显示。 按下设置 DCA1000按钮后、FPGA 版本显示为0.0.0.0。 按下设置 DCA1000窗口中的连接按钮后、窗口将显示与之前相同的 FPGA 版本(2.7 Record Bit File)、但 DCA1000 Arm 按钮仍呈灰色显示。

    2.我还没有尝试过这种方法。 这是使用 Uniflash 完成的吗?

    谢谢、
    Sam
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

          e2e.ti.com/.../Run_5F00_After_5F00_Uniflash_5F00_format.txtHiJitendra、

    假设我将使用 uniflash 擦除 sFlash、我执行了以下步骤(我不确定是否正确执行了)、因此我在这里详细介绍了这些步骤。

    1.将 AWR1243BOOST 置于 SOP5模式(跳线放置101)。

    打开 Uniflash 并看到所附第一张图片中所示的屏幕。

    3.从菜单中选择 AWR1243BOOST 器件、并看到第二张图片所示的屏幕。 然后、我按下了"开始"按钮、该按钮将我带到屏幕、如图3所示。

    4.导航至设置和实用程序选项卡并将 COM 端口更改为用户/UART 端口。 (参见图4)。

    5.我尝试搜索“擦除”,但没有结果(见图5)。 然后、我假定正确的操作过程是按下格式 sFlash 按钮、该按钮会显示一个进度屏幕、其结果显示在最后的图片中。

    此时、我假设我已成功擦除 sFlash。

    不幸的是,同样的问题仍然存在。 我还附加了此擦除后运行中的日志、以防它非常有用。

    谢谢、

    Sam

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    电路板可能有缺陷。 您是否可以将其退回?

    谢谢你

    Cesar

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Cesar、

    该电路板(DCA1000) 是通过 Mouser Electronics 购买的、我收到了他们发送的以下电子邮件:

    "感谢您发送电子邮件。 我们的技术团队已指导您联系制造商寻求帮助。

    您需要在 http://e2e.ti.com 上注册并提交技术支持请求

    如果德州仪器认为该器件存在缺陷、他们将建议我们帮助进行更换或退款。"

    这是 TI 可以帮助的吗?

    谢谢、

    Sam

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    Sam、

    根据您提供给我们的所有信息、您的电路板可能出现故障。 请遵循获取替换 DCA1000EVM 的过程。

    此致、
    Kyle
x 出现错误。请重试或与管理员联系。